What Are Self-Emptying Robot Vacuums and Mops?

Self-emptying robot vacuums and mops are automated gadgets developed to clean floors by vacuuming and mopping without continuous human intervention. What sets self-emptying models apart is their capability to empty their dustbin instantly into a base station. This feature not just makes them convenient however also decreases the requirement for regular maintenance, giving users more time to focus on other activities.

Key Features of Self-Emptying Robot Vacuums and Mops

Feature Description
Automatic Emptying The robot go back to the base station and empties its dustbin instantly.
Mopping Functionality Some designs have a mopping function that can clean difficult surfaces after vacuuming.
Smart Navigation Advanced sensing units and cameras help the robot navigate around challenges and create effective cleaning paths.
Mobile App Connectivity Many models provide smart device apps that permit users to control the vacuum, schedule cleansings, and track cleaning development.
Voice Assistant Integration Suitable with smart home systems like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ant for hands-free operation.
HEPA Filters High-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ters catch irritants and great dust, making them appropriate for allergy sufferers.
Several Cleaning Modes Alternatives for area cleaning, edge cleaning, and scheduled cleansings.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How does the self-emptying function work?

Self-emptying robot vacuums and mops come with a base station that collects particles from the robot’s dustbin after cleaning. Typically, the robot returns to the base station when its battery is low or after finishing its cleaning cycle. The station then utilizes suction to empty the dustbin.

2. How typically do I need to empty the base station?

Many self-emptying designs have bags or containers in the base station that can hold numerous robot bin loads, normally lasting a number of weeks to a couple of months, depending on use. Users will be notified through the app or device alerts when it’s time to change the bag.

3. Can a self-emptying robot vacuum manage family pet hair?

Yes! The effective suction and specialized brushes of numerous self-emptying robot vacuums are developed to manage pet hair effectively. Designs like the iRobot Roomba s9+ have actually functions specifically targeted at capturing dirt and animal hair.

4. Are self-emptying robot vacuums efficient for big spaces?

Yes, most self-emptying designs are equipped with sophisticated mapping technologies, allowing them to track their cleaning paths and effectively manage large locations. Users can customize cleaning schedules for various rooms and areas at various times.

5. Do self-emptying robots require upkeep?

While they are designed for very little maintenance, routine upkeep consists of cleaning the brushes and filters as well as changing the base station’s bag. Following the manufacturer’s instructions can make sure optimum efficiency.
